Synopsis

Edit

Seacor Holdings, a diversified holding company with interests in domestic and international transportation, agreed to acquire remaining shares in SEA-Vista, an operator of a fleet petroleum and chemical carriers servicing the US coastwise trade of crude oil, petroleum, and chemical products, from Avista Capital Partners for $106m in cash and 1.5m common stock. “Acquiring full ownership of SEA-Vista underpins our continued commitment to remaining a leader in the transportation and logistics industry. We appreciate the support of our former partner, Avista, during our newbuild program and our shared mission to building a safer, more environmentally friendly, fleet of modern vessels.” Eric Fabrikant, Seacor Holdings COO.
